Abstract PGE501 3.0.34

Geolocation team revised source code to activate the flagging of SAA and Eclipses and set QA Flag accordingly. QA Flag was already present, but the flagging had been inadvertently disabled. Will want to reprocess days for SNPP C2 and JPSS1 C2.1 from mission where eclipses occurred so flag is set appropriately. See attached document for list of dates impacted that will be reprocessed.

Products Affected V[NP|J1]03[IMG|MOD|DNB]
Software Affected PGE501 3.0.34
Processing String to Receive the Change S-NPP Forward Processin. J1 Forward Processing. J1 Reprocessing.
Downstream Product Effects All VIIRS land products
Data Granules to be Used for Science Testing A science test was conducted, to confirm the new PGE501/Geolocation code flagged eclipses correctly.
Justification Enabling the flagging of the SAA and Eclipses will provide more accurate information to science team members that need to exclude data impacted by these events.
Effective Date for Implementation of Change PGE501 v3.0.34 will go into forward processing in SNPP AS5200 and JPSS1 AS5201 starting 01/18/2022 (first data day for update to be used). Reprocessing of data days impacted by eclipses will begin on 01/17/2022 and days to be reprocessed are in attached document.
